Why Knowing Your Exact Aquarium Volume Matters
Before diving into the formulas, it helps to understand why accuracy is so essential in the fishkeeping hobby. Water is the life support group of water life, and maintaining steady chemical specifications requires exact measurements.
- Medication Dosing: Overdosing medications can easily prove fatal to Fish Stock Calculator and invertebrates, while underdosing can render treatments inadequate against pathogens and parasites. Most medication guidelines need precise gallon measurements.
- Water Treatment & & Conditioners: Dechlorinators, pH buffers, and basic fertilizers are created for specific gallon increments. Accurate volume calculations prevent chemical imbalances.
- Equipping Limits: The classic "one inch of Fish Tank Calculator Volume per gallon" rule is dated, however hobbyists still rely heavily on gallon metrics to compute biological load and avoid overstocking.
- Devices Sizing: Heaters, filters, and protein skimmers are rated based on water volume. An undersized filter will struggle to keep water quality, while a large heating system can trigger harmful temperature level variations.
Standard Aquarium Shapes and Formulas
To determine the volume of an aquarium, one should use standard geometry. Because liquids take the shape of their containers, determining water volume depends on determining the interior dimensions of the tank (length, width, and height) instead of the outside, that includes glass density and plastic rims.
1. Rectangular Aquariums
The most common and straightforward design.
- The Formula: ₤ text Volume (Gallons) = frac text Length (in) times text Width (in) times text Height (in) 231 ₤
- Note: Dividing by 231 converts cubic inches into United States liquid gallons.
2. Bow-Front Aquariums
Bow-front tanks provide a breathtaking watching experience due to their curved front glass. Since the front panel juts outside, basic rectangular formulas will ignore the total volume.
- The Formula: To find the volume of a bow-front tank, calculate the volume as if it were a basic rectangle using the typical depth (the average of the shallowest side width and the deepest center width).
3. Cylinder Aquariums
Cylindrical tanks supply 360-degree seeing angles and make striking focal points in a room.
- The Formula: ₤ text Volume (Gallons) = frac pi times r ^ 2 times text Height (in) 231 ₤
- Where: ₤ r ₤ is the radius (half of the diameter) of the cylinder.

To achieve the most accurate reading with an aquarium volume calculator in gallons, enthusiasts need to follow a detailed measuring procedure:
- Measure the Interior: Using a tape measure, measure the inside length, inside width, and the height of the water line (not the overall height of the glass).
- Convert to Inches: If measurements were taken in centimeters, convert them by dividing by ₤ 2.54 ₤. (For centimeters, the divisor changes to ₤ 3,785 ₤ to discover gallons, or you can determine in liters first and increase by ₤ 0.264 ₤ to convert to US gallons).
- Increase the Dimensions: Multiply Length ₤ times ₤ Width ₤ times ₤ Water Height.
- Divide by 231: Divide the resulting cubic inch item by ₤ 231 ₤.
Example Calculation:
Imagine a custom tank with an interior length of ₤ 36 ₤ inches, a width of ₤ 18 ₤ inches, and a water height of ₤ 20 ₤ inches.
- ₤ 36 times 18 times 20 = 12,960 text cubic inches ₤
- ₤ 12,960 div 231 = 56.1 ₤ gallons.
Elements That Reduce Actual Water Volume
Once the physical volume of the empty tank is computed, it is simple to assume that is just how much water goes inside. However, internal hardscape and devices displace water. Failing to represent displacement can cause unintentional over-dosing of medications or water treatments.
Common aspects that displace water consist of:
- Substrate: A two-inch layer of aquarium gravel, sand, or aqua soil in a big tank can displace several gallons of water.
- Hardscape: Large pieces of driftwood, lava rock, and dragon stone take up a surprising quantity of space inside the aquarium.
- Backgrounds and 3D Structures: Internal background panels include depth and beauty, however they press water displacement levels higher.
- Equipment: Internal filters, heaters, and overflow boxes minimize the general liquid capability.
The "Substrate and Hardscape" Estimation Rule
As a general general rule, heavy decorations, thick substrates, and rockwork typically minimize total tank water volume by 10% to 15%. For example, if a bare tank holds 100 gallons, the actual water volume in a greatly aquascaped setup might only be around 85 to 90 gallons.
